>Anybody have any experience with towing quattros a few hundred miles?
>I need to get my TQC back from the Bay Area. What's U-haul like?
I would suggest getting all the wheels off the ground, like a flatbed truck
or on a trailer. I will be towing mine in the next few weeks and I will be
using a flatbed/car hauling tandem axel trailer. On checking around U-haul
wanted something like $50/day. Ryder only rents their trailers to be towed
behind their trucks. There were local rental places which only rented
trailers for 'in-state' use. As for insurance, my coverage covers my vehicle
doing the towing and my car on the trailer. The trailer needs to be insured
by the owner of the trailer. My insurance wouldn't cover damage to the
trailer if something bad happens.
